She was a CEO in disguise, craving a simple life. He was a workaholic who never noticed the love standing right in front of him. A contract marriage, broken hearts, and years apart couldn't erase what they truly felt.

When he finally realizes what he's lost, she's no longer just the quiet housewife he thought he knew-she's strong, radiant, and unstoppable. Now, he has to earn back her love, piece by piece...

From playful jealousy and heartfelt confessions to cozy nights and second-chance promises, this is a story of love, growth, and the moments that truly matter.

Will he change in time, or will the life they dreamed of together slip away forever?
